Chapter 40: Chapter 40 Skill Book

Aidan and the others ate their meals while they chatted with each other. He also opened up about his world, of course, he didn't forget to add a little bit of lie to the narrative. He wasn't sure why he needed to lie at Maninsov the first time he told this story. But since the lie already started it would be awkward to change the narrative now.

"No eels sky?" Kalukaga asked. It was probably Aidan's first time seeing him so shocked.

The information was indeed shocking. All this time, the sky had been blocked by the eels for all they knew. Now, someone told them that instead of eels, the world was shone by a floating ball of gas in the sky. It would be hard to believe that.

At least for the native here.

"Wow, you're not from this continent, Aidan?" Sofiel asked before she sip her orange juice.

"You can say that." Aidan grabbed a fork and ate. The food was ordered by Gomon so he didn't know what this was. It looked like meat but the color was blue. The taste was good, so he didn't have any complaints.

"Gomon, what is this?"

"It's Icy Genies," Gomon said, putting the same blue meat inside his mouth with a fork.

"Genies?" Aidan asked. He had been curious about these genies before. "What are they anyway. Can they make your wish come true?"

"No," Gomon said, chewing. "But they can make you fall asleep and dreams about the thing you want the most."

"The thing I want the most? That's very interesting."

"They can also freeze you to death," Maninsov added. He picked up some kind of vegetable with his fork. There was no meat in his plate.

Was he a vegetarian?

"Oh, wow," Aidan said. "And people hunt them for their meat?" This was probably the most exotics meat he had eaten. A literal genie.

"There's another much more dangerous creature that people hunt," Maninsov said.

Aidan nodded. He didn't doubt that at all. With the power people had here, hunting strong creatures might be a fun activity for them. "I just recalled. I need to fight that bobodactly again."

"You mean Recpeodatyl?" Gomon said.

"Yes, that one. I always forgot its name."

"Why do you need to fight it?" Gomon asked.

Aidan explained the punishment that teacher Stras gave him. He also told them about his failure in defeating the bird and had to hurry up to become stronger before the bird become an adult.

The fight against the cultist was actually a great opportunity for him to level up, but because he could only kill a few of them, Aidan didn't get that much experience to level up.

Maninsov stood up. "Then let's train you up. We'll hunt a beast or two in the backyard."

Gomon and the others groaned.

Even Aidan winced at the thought of returning to the school's backyard. What if another cultists group captured them? Clearly, the school wasn't good at detecting intruders.

"Come on," Maninsov said. "The Ramthall family has cleared them out, in fact, they probably already scoured the entire kingdom."

"I help," Kalukaga said.

"Aidan is my good friend," Gomon said. "I will help him as much as I can."

Siraye looked away. "I am not going."

Sofiel wrapped her arms around Siraye's, chest pressing tight.

Aidan shook his head and looked away.

What's wrong with me?

"Come on, Siraye," Sofiel said. "It will be fun if we all go together."

She sighed. "Alright. But don't blame me if I run first."

Aidan smiled. When they fought against the shaman, Siraye didn't leave them even when she said that she would. She had stayed and fought.

"That decides it then," Maninsov said. "Let's leave after we finish eating."

Aidan and the others continued to chat as they ate. They continued to talk about their experience in the pit. Aidan also asked them how did they turn into demons the other day.

They told him that they saw demons too. But, in their case, Aidan was the demon. So the cultists must have used some kind of illusion spell on them.

It was scary to think about.

Illusion spell was scary because Aidan wouldn't know if the one he fought was his enemy or not. What if he met someone like that on his travel?

He should get stronger. That was the only solution.

After they finished their meal, Aidan and the others walked to the Mission Hall.

The humanoid snake receptionist flicked her finger out. "Nice to see you alive. How can I help?"

Adan raised an eyebrow at her first sentence. Did people die often here?

"We would like to take these missions." Maninsov handed her a parchment that he had taken off the board.

"And who would be in your team?" She asked.

Maninsov then told her their names.

"Sorry, but two of your friends haven't finished their mission yet. You have two options. Either cancel the mission and pay the fine or finish the mission."

"How much is the fine?" Gomon asked.

"30 gold and 45 silver," the receptionist replied.

Gomon stepped back. "I'm not rich enough to pay for that. Sorry, Aidan."

Maninsov turned back. "I guess we'll just have to finish the mission. What is the mission?"

"I am not sure if I remember it correctly, but I think we need to kill something called goccego. Some kind of crocodile monster," Aidan said.

"Kroccego?" Gomon said.

"Ah, yes, that one."

"Can I see the paper?" Maninsov asked.

"Lost," Kalukaga replied. He probably lost it while they were being kidnapped.

"That's fine," Maninsov said. "Let's go then. Is all of you prepared?"

"Wait," Aidan said. "I need to get a weapon. I am tired of fighting only with my fist."

"Really?" Maninsov asked. "You are so good with your fists. You sure you want to use a sword?"

"I am sure. I want some armor with that too. A light armor is fine."

Maninsov nodded. "You know what. Maybe we should train you first before finishing the mission. You just got into this school right?"

Aidan nodded. "Yes."

"Then let's train you first. I and the others will spare with you in the training field. You can also get some books about sword techniques in the library."

Aidan's eyes lit up. "I like the sound of that."
